Over the course of the last half-century, the United Kingdom has seen the far reaching development of equal opportunities law.
It is no longer acceptable for employers to base employment-related decisions on any of the following grounds: age; disability; race; religion or belief; sex; sexual orientation; gender reassignment; marital or civil partnership status; maternity or pregnancy.
Anti-discrimination legislation provides protection to employees and prospective employees who are treated less favourably on any of the grounds specified above, and the employer is unable to show that the treatment in question is justifiable.
